@valentineNANA The unrecognized graphics card can be annoying but doesn't prevent Sims 3 from running well, so the first step is to get it working again. For that, please repair the game: open your EA App game library, click Sims 3, and select Manage > Repair.
Next, apply the Alder Lake patch to TS3.exe, or use one of the other workarounds for the Alder Lake (and newer) issue covered in the accepted solution of this thread:
Before doing anything else, test the game, and let me know whether it runs. Check the DeviceConfig.log again to see whether Sims 3 is using your Intel iGPU or the Nvidia card, also fixable if necessary.
